Does Medical Aid cover Cosmetic Surgery?
Generally most Medical Aids do not pay for Cosmetic Surgery as it is viewed as a Scheme Exclusion.

Do I need a referral?
Dr Barnes is able to see any patient without a referral, however, some medical aids may not pay for services in full if you have not been referred by a GP. Please contact your medical aid to ask what your plan stipulates.
